Cedartown has been away from home for two games now, but on Wednesday they'll finally make their return. They will host the South Paulding Spartans at 5:30 p.m.
On Tuesday, Cedartown came up short against Cartersville and fell 8-3. The Bulldogs have struggled against the Hurricanes recently, as their game on Tuesday was their fourth consecutive lost matchup.
Meanwhile, South Paulding came tearing into Thursday's contest with five straight wins (a stretch where they outscored their opponents by an average of 9 runs) and they left with even more momentum. Their pitchers stepped up to hand the Jaguar a 15-0 shutout. The Spartans might be getting used to big wins seeing as the team has won ten matchups by eight runs or more this season.
Cedartown's loss dropped their record down to 16-12. As for South Paulding, they are on a roll lately: they've won nine of their last ten matches, which provided a nice bump to their 14-7 record this season.
